Job Description

Position Overview: As a Masonry Estimator, you will play a pivotal role in helping our clients choose the right Masonry solutions. You will work closely with our sales and installation teams to ensure accurate estimates and quotes are provided to clients, creating a seamless and satisfying customer experience.

Responsibilities:

* Prepare detailed and accurate cost estimates for masonry projects, including materials, labor, equipment, and subcontractor costs.
* Analyze project plans, specifications, and blueprints to determine scope and requirements.
* Collaborate with project managers, architects, and clients to clarify project details and requirements.
* Develop and maintain relationships with suppliers and subcontractors to secure competitive pricing.
* Manage bid proposals and ensure timely submission of estimates to meet deadlines.
* Conduct site visits as needed to assess conditions, verify measurements, and confirm project scope.
* Assist in value engineering and offer alternative solutions to optimize project budgets.
* Track and analyze historical cost data to improve accuracy in future estimates.

Qualifications:

* Proven experience as a Masonry Estimator or similar role in the construction industry.
* Strong understanding of masonry materials, techniques, and labor requirements.
* Proficiency in estimating software and tools (e.g., PlanSwift, Bluebeam, or similar).
* Excellent analytical and mathematical skills with attention to detail.
* Ability to read and interpret blueprints, technical drawings, and project specifications.
* Effective communication and negotiation skills.
* Self-motivated, organized, and able to manage multiple tasks in a fast-paced environment.
* High school diploma or equivalent required; a degree in construction management, engineering, or a related field is a plus.
